What are Digital Twins?
Digital twins are virtual replicas of physical objects or systems. Think of them as highly detailed, dynamic simulations that mirror the real-world counterparts. These aren’t just static models; they’re constantly updated with real-time data, allowing for accurate predictions and proactive adjustments. This dynamic mirroring is key to their power, enabling businesses to anticipate problems before they even arise and make data-driven decisions to improve efficiency. Imagine having a virtual copy of your entire manufacturing plant, allowing you to simulate different scenarios and optimize production processes in a completely risk-free environment. That’s the reality digital twins offer.
Types of Digital Twins
The applications of digital twins are incredibly diverse and span numerous industries. We can broadly classify digital twins into several types, each catering to a specific need:
- Product Digital Twins: Used to optimize design and performance of products throughout their lifecycle, from concept to disposal.
- Process Digital Twins: Simulate operational processes to identify bottlenecks and improve efficiency. These are crucial for supply chain optimization and predictive maintenance.
- System Digital Twins: These twins encompass the broadest scope, encompassing entire systems such as power grids, smart cities, or even entire ecosystems.
Building Your Own Digital Twin: A Step-by-Step Guide
Creating a digital twin is not as daunting as it may sound. While the complexity can vary widely depending on the specific application, the core principles remain consistent. The process typically involves:
Data Acquisition and Integration
The foundation of any successful digital twin is a solid data infrastructure. You need to collect data from multiple sources, including sensors, databases, and simulations. This data integration is critical for creating a comprehensive and accurate representation of the physical asset.
Model Development
This involves using sophisticated software to create a virtual model that accurately represents the physical system. The model should incorporate relevant parameters and incorporate algorithms for simulation and prediction. This step often leverages techniques from machine learning to enhance the accuracy and predictive capabilities of the digital twin.
Data Visualization and Analysis
With a complete digital twin in place, the next stage involves visualizing and analyzing the data. This is where you can monitor performance, identify potential problems, and make data-driven decisions to optimize the physical system. Powerful dashboards and analytics tools are essential for extracting actionable insights.
Digital Twin Use Cases Across Industries
The applications of digital twins extend far and wide, transforming industries and revolutionizing business processes:
Manufacturing and Production
In manufacturing, digital twins are used for predictive maintenance, improving product design, and optimizing production lines. This leads to significant cost savings, reduced downtime, and improved overall efficiency. Real-time monitoring and analysis of production processes reveal hidden inefficiencies, making manufacturing processes smarter and more responsive.
Healthcare
Digital twins in healthcare have the potential to personalize treatment plans, accelerate drug development, and improve surgical outcomes. By creating virtual models of patients’ organs and systems, doctors can plan procedures and therapies more effectively.
Smart Cities
Digital twins of cities help urban planners optimize traffic flow, improve infrastructure management, and address environmental challenges. By simulating various scenarios, city managers can proactively prepare for and mitigate potential problems.
Supply Chain Management
Digital twin technology is highly effective in streamlining and enhancing supply chain management. Simulating various supply chain scenarios enables companies to predict disruptions and optimize logistics with incredible efficiency. This results in substantial cost savings and increased customer satisfaction.
